10612 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 21280. Its totient is φ = 4536.

The previous prime is 10607. The next prime is 10613. The reversal of 10612 is 21601.

10612 is nontrivially palindromic in base 13.

10612 is digitally balanced in base 2, because in such base it contains all the possibile digits an equal number of times.

10612 is an admirable number.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×106122 = 225229088, which contains 22 as substring.

It is a congruent number.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(10613) by changing a digit.

10612 is an untouchable number, because it is not equal to the sum of proper divisors of any number.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(7)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 162 + ... + 217.

210612 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

10612 is a primitive ab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ors, none of which is abundant.

It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.

It is a Zumkeller number, because its divisors can be partitioned in two sets with the same sum (10640).

10612 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

10612 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 390 (or 388 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 12, while the sum is 10.

The square root of 10612 is about 103.0145620774. The cubic root of 10612 is about 21.9751786175.

The spelling of 10612 in words is "ten thousand, six hundred twelve".

Divisors: 1 2 4 7 14 28 379 758 1516 2653 5306 10612
